![]() Ingest data to the table without access to query the data.įull permission in the scope of a particular external table.įull permission to alter the view, delete the view, and grant admin permissions to another principal.įull permission to alter the function, delete the function, and grant admin permissions to another principal. show commands in the context of the database and its child entities.įull permission in the scope of a particular table. Ingest data to all tables in the database without access to query the data.Įxecute. All users managed through this interface are stored in the protected users system collection. Let's consider we've that base to better follow the current write-up which will show the use of ArangoDB as database management system into a NodeJS project. The interface provides the means to manage database system users. We've also experimented the command-line and graphical tools to perform some queries on databases, collections and users. Read all data and metadata, including in tables with the RestrictedViewAccess policy turned on. The HTTP API for user management lets you create, modify, delete, and list ArangoDB user accounts, as well as grant and revoke permissions for databases and collections. Read all data and metadata, except for tables with the RestrictedViewAccess policy turned on. Create tables and functions, and become the admin for those tables and functions. Read all data and metadata of the database. show commands in the context of any database in the cluster.įull permission in the scope of a particular database. Read all data and metadata of any database in the cluster.Įxecute. May show and alter certain cluster-level policies. Scopeįull permission to all databases in the cluster. The Manage column offers ways to add or remove role principals. When multiple roles are listed in the Dependencies column, only one of them is needed to obtain the role. The HTTP API for user management lets you create, modify, delete, and list ArangoDB user accounts, as well as grant and revoke permissions for databases and. For example, to become a Table Admin, you must first have a role like Database User or a role that includes the permissions of Database User, such as Database Admin or AllDatabasesAdmin. Next, we should set the new database name (In this tutorial, we will set it to TestGraph). The Dependencies column lists the minimum roles required to obtain the role in that row. To add a new database, in the left side menu, click on Databases, then click on the Add Database button as shown in the image below. The Permissions column displays the access granted to each role. The following table outlines the roles and permissions available at each scope. To assign ARM permissions, see Assign Azure roles using the Azure portal. To delete a database, you need at least Contributor ARM permissions on the cluster.
0 Comments
Leave a Reply. |